Frequently asked questions about Wi-Fi

How do I know which Wi-Fi network I should connect to?

When you visit a courthouse that has Wi-Fi, you should connect to: Court-Guest. When you select Court-Guest, a page will open where you can accept the use terms and connect to the network.

My court does not have a projected date listed, does that mean we are not getting Wi-Fi?

The team will be filling in date on a rolling basis as more information comes back from internet providers, wiring teams, and the Wi-Fi architects.  Each courthouse is unique, requiring analysis to be done in each location and different buildings often bring different challenges which impacts the delivery schedule.
